Introduction

Magelight in essence is the ability for a magic users with a certain affinity for Transfiguration magic or household magic (Though to a smaller degree) to alter the world around them and create light around them in varying colors, and being able to form light as dim as a candle or as bright as the sun itself in some cases, in order to provide light in the dark, or to ward away different creatures. Normally magelight will take on the appearance of a simple orb of light that is cast from the palms of one's hands though truly is up to the mage how they aesthetically cast it and may differ from mage to mage.

How

Magelight is formed via the alteration of the very air around you using voidal magic. Similar to how a cleric may create clerical light though very much different in having no holy properties to it. Though, it is more versatile. The mage must first connect their minds to the void like all other void magics. Once connected the mystic will then focus on a point around them in which they plan to create the magelight. After focusing on the point the mage is then able to form the light, by replicating it in the void and much like evocation summoning the light from the void. The magic normally isn’t very taxing if used simply to light up an area masters of arcana being able to summon the magelight forth almost indefinitely with little strain or fatigue. (Basically if used solely as a light source it would take up little to no mana) The second part to magelight requiring more experienced mages who practice the arts of transfiguration is being able to heighten the intensity of the light they summon. Though, it cannot compete with a cleric’s light to be used to blind people for a short while it is possible if used with enough mana to replicate the brightness of the sun though most likely for a short amount of time as it would be taxing to create such intense light for longer than a few moments without feeling a significant strain in the mages’ mana pool. This effect could be used as a distraction or to ward away more unsavory creatures of the night.

Aesthetics

Aesthetically It is really up to the caster of the magelight how they want to conjure the light and even how it looks able to take on the appearance of different colors of light from reds, greens, yellows, white and so on. Though leaving out blacklight as characters ICly most likely wouldn’t be able to study it or know what it is.

Redlines

  • Mage light is a household magic when used as simple orbs of light (Up to the brightness of a torch)
  • Only transfigurationists can ramp up the light to a much more brighter state brighter than simple orbs of light. Basically anything brighter than a torch.
  • The light produces no heat, it is simply creating light
  • The light cannot directly harm dark creatures like holy magic does, it's just light!
